Full description

This is the day for travellers who have already walked the medina and want the opposite: silence, a pool, a long lunch and a horizon. Agafay's camps sit in the stone hills west of Marrakech, and their pools face straight out into the desert with the Atlas beyond.

You are collected in the morning and driven out of the city. From arrival, the day is yours: swim, take a lounger, use the shaded lounge areas, and eat lunch on a terrace over the desert. There is no schedule to keep and no activity you have to join.

Lunch is Moroccan — salads, a tagine or couscous main and mint tea. Tell us about dietary needs when you book and we brief the kitchen; we do not print a fixed menu because camps adjust it by season.

It is a good choice for families with a free day, for groups where half want adventure and half want a lounger, and for anyone whose Marrakech riad has no pool. If you would like to add a camel ride or a buggy hour to the same day, we sell those separately and can attach them to your booking.

Good to know before you book

  • Agafay is stone desert, not dunes, and there is very little natural shade away from the camp.
  • Pool rules, opening hours and towel provision are set by the camp and confirmed for your date when you book.
  • The desert is hot at midday in summer — the shaded areas matter more than you expect.
  • Tell us about dietary requirements in advance so the kitchen can prepare.
